I believe that the is a recognised medical condition which makes some people more prone to be dazzled than others. I am totally crap driving at night, I find it really hard to see when faced with oncoming lights. I do all the things which everyone has mentioned, but most importantly adjust my speed to what I am capable of dealing with.
It is also worthwhile bearing in mind that if you are having trouble seeing, then the other drivers could well be as well. |
